FLAIL UNIT HEIGHT OF CUT ADJUSTMENT _______________________________
TO ADJUST SPANNER TYPE:
1.
Fit pin in range 1 or 2 (depending on height and
condition of grass) on cutter head mounting,
fasten with R-clip.
Note
As a Guide, it is recommended that you test the cutter head
mounting in both positions to get results best matched to
your cutting conditions.
Range 1
Decreases the height of the opening at the front of the
mower head. This setting will allow a lower height of cut. It
is best suited for regularly maintained turf up to a height of
75 mm (3 inch).
Range 2
Increases the height of the opening at the front of the
mower head to allow longer material to be cut. The
minimum height of cut is restricted on this setting. It is best
suited to mow longer material to a maximum of 200 mm (8
inch) or areas with irregular growth.
To adjust the cutter head from range 1 to range 2 can give a
quick height of cut change to adapt to different conditions.
2.
Release the locknut (B) below the adjuster (A) on
both sides of cutting unit.
3.
Turn the adjuster (A) at the rear of the unit to the
right to decrease the height of cut, or to the left to
increase the height of cut. The grooves (C) are a
rough indicator for setting the roll parallel.
4.
After adjusting secure by tightening locknut on
both sides of cutting unit.
